Oneida Airman Receives Meritorious Service Medal from New York Air National Guard

The 224th Air Defense Group recently presented service medals for outstanding performance to the following New York Air National Guardsmen.

Maj. Peter Onan, Oneida, Meritorious Service Medal. A mission crew commander at the 224th Air Defense Squadron (ADS), Onan was recognized for his outstanding work directing operations supporting Presidential flights and National Special Security Events. Other contributions included developing and conducting qualification training for more than 60 Airmen, and spearheading the unit's participation in a $1.6 billion test and evaluation project.

The 224th Air Defense Group (ADG) is composed of the 224th Air Defense Squadron and 224th Support Squadron, located in Rome, and Detachment 1 and Detachment 2 that serve in the Washington, D.C. area. The 224th ADG provides the forces to conduct the Eastern Air Defense Sector's (EADS) mission. Part of the North American Aerospace Defense Command (NORAD), the Sector is responsible for the air defense of the eastern U.S.
